Used car dealer charged with possession of stolen vehicle - Trinidad and Tobago Newsday

Summary by newsday.co.tt
A San Juan used car dealer is expected to appear before a master of the High Court on August 4, charged with possession of a stolen vehicle. The man was identified as 33-year-old Brandon Mohammed. A police statement on July 3 said Mohammed was arrested by officers of the Stolen Vehicles Squad while they were conducting investigations into a 2024 report of a stolen Nissan Frontier.
